MySQL默认只允许root帐户在本地登录,如果要在其它机器上连接mysql,必须修改root允许远程连接。 其操作简单,如下所示: 1. 进入mysql: 2. 使用mysql库: 3. 查看用户表: 4. 更新用户表:(其中%的意思 ...
问题描述:MySQL数据库安装成功后,在服务器本地可以连接成功,但是使用工具navicat无法进行远程连接,如图: 原因:MySQL默认只允许root帐户在本地登录,如果要在其它机器上连接mysql,必须修改root允许远程连接。 解决方法: . 进入mysql: usr local mysql bin mysql u root p 根据服务器安装的数据库地址而定 或者 mysql uroot p ...
2020-01-01 22:46 0 2961 推荐指数:
MySQL默认只允许root帐户在本地登录,如果要在其它机器上连接mysql,必须修改root允许远程连接。 其操作简单,如下所示: 1. 进入mysql: 2. 使用mysql库: 3. 查看用户表: 4. 更新用户表:(其中%的意思 ...
前言 最近开发中遇到一个问题,mysql在服务器本地可以登录,但是远程通过3306端口却不可以。这个问题困扰了我一周之久,终于在今天解决了。在解决的过程中试了很多的方法,遂记录下来,希望能给大家一些提示。 排查错误位置 客户端方面 首先通过ping命令对服务器进行测试,如果ping不通 ...
修改root 密码 ALTER USER "root"@"localhost" IDENTIFIED BY "你的新密码"; 提示意思是不能用grant创建用户,mysql8.0以前的版本可以使用grant在授权的时候隐式的创建用户,8.0以后已经不支持,所以必须先创建用户,然后再授权,命令 ...
为了安全考虑,OneinStack仅允许云主机本机(localhost)连接数据库,如果需要远程连接数据库,需要如下操作:打开iptables 3306端口 # iptables -I INPUT 4 -p tcp -m state --state NEW -m tcp --dport 3306 ...
在CentOS6.5上安装了Mysql5.6,,本地服务启动成功,但是远程使用Navicat无法远程连接到MySQL数据库,为了解决这个问题,方法如下: (1)先将MySQL服务停掉# service mysqd stop (2)查看MySQL配置文件# vi /etc/my.cnf特别要留意 ...
起因 今天在ubuntu16.04环境下通过mysql workbench访问远程数据库时,发现无法连接问题,解决思路及方法记录如下,不足之处,请多指教。 问题 通过workbench输入密码访问时报这个错: 思路 网络问题,更换网络之后重启 ...
今天公司要部署一个系统到阿里云的ECS服务器, 数据库不是RDS 需要自己安装 我安装的是 mariadb-10.3.10-winx64.msi 我的操作系统是windows server 2012 r2 安装完毕之后, 创建用户 .... 设置密码 OK 远程 ...
很明显就是无法连接远程的mysql 下面我们就开始来解决这个问题 首先,我们通过xshell登陆远 ...